The Waldo Jail is a privately-run detention center at PO Drawer B, Waldo, FL, 32694, Alachua County County. Waldo Jail holds up to 22 male and 15 female pre-trial offenders facing misdemeanor or felony charges for a maximum of 84 hours. The Waldo Jail runs an Inmate Trusty Program, allowing arrestees to “work off” their time as directed by the courts. Waldo Jail outsources its employees from G4S Secure Solutions, working under the Waldo Police Department Administrative Lieutenant Sadie Darnell.The Waldo Jail’s jailers get prior training from the Florida Standard and Corrections STC certified Corrections Officer Academy. Also, they undergo a 36-hours continuous training every two years.

Sending a Mail/Care Package
Do you need to send mail or a package to an inmate at the Waldo Jail? Ensure you address the correspondence as follows: -
Inmate's Full Names,
Waldo Jail inmate’s ID
PO Drawer B, Waldo, FL, 32694
Ensure that your mail or package is permissible as per the approved list of items. Call the Waldo Jail administration at 352-468-1515 to confirm.
Sending Money
Inmates at the Waldo Jail have access to a commissary account, allowing them to receive and spend money on their personal items. Friends and family can top up these Waldo Jail accounts via cash, check, or money order deposits. Quote the inmate's full names and Waldo Jail inmate’s ID at the back of the slip for quick funds allocation.
Phone calls
Inmates in Waldo Jail are free to call their legal counsel, employers, family members, or friends as per the approved members' list. These are 20-minute collect calls between 9 am and 7 pm each day.
Visitation
The Waldo Jail allows up to 1 adults and 2 minors to visit an inmate at a go. The children must be in the company of a parent or a legal guardian. The visits at Waldo Jail take place on Monday to Saturday from 9 am to 4 pm. Emergency visits to Waldo Jail are also allowed, subject to the on-duty Watch Commander's approval.
